412

On motion of Ald: J. Carson seconded by Ald: Gordon

Ordered, That the Report of the Committee on
Fire, Water and Gas be received and adopted and that
the Finance Committee provide funds for the required
alterations

The Auditors Report was read and referred to the
Committee on Finance and Accounts

On motion of Ald: McIntyre seconded by Ald: Smythe
Ordered, That the Council go into Committee of
the whole on the second reading of the By Law to exempt
real and personal property of the Montreal Transportation
Company and of the Kingston and Montreal Forwarding
Company

Yeas Aldermen. Clements, Crothers, Creeggan
Gildersleeve, Gordon, McIntyre, Quigley, Redden, Shaw
Smythe, Whiting, J. Wilson 12.

Nays Aldermen Allen, J. Carson, R.J. Carson, Downing
Dunn, Law, W. Wilson 7

The Council went into Committee of the whole on
the second reading

Ald: Dunn in the chair

The Council resumed

The Committee rose and the Chairman reported the
second reading of the By Law clause by clause the
report was received.

Yeas Aldermen. Clements, Crothers, Creeggan
Gildersleeve, Gordon, McIntyre, Quigley, Redden
Shaw, Smythe, Whiting, J. Wilson 12.

Nays Mayor Livingston, Aldn Allen, J. Carson, R.J. Carson
Downing, Dunn, Law, W. Wilson 8.

Ald: Smythe moves seconded by Ald: McIntyre
That this Council do now stand adjourned
until Thursday the 19th day of April instant which
being put was lost

On motion the Council adjourned

M. Flanagan, City Clerk

C. Livingston, Mayor
